Fenerbahçe Beko Advances to Turkish Basketball Cup Final Four

Table of Contents

Fenerbahçe Beko's advancement to the Final Four of the Turkish Basketball Cup reflects the club's strong performance in Turkish basketball, a sport that has deep cultural roots in Turkey. Basketball has grown significantly in popularity in Turkey over the past few decades, with clubs like Fenerbahçe Beko becoming symbols of local pride and community identity. The team's success not only boosts its reputation but also enhances the visibility of basketball in the region, attracting more fans and potential sponsors. The match against Safiport Erokspor was a competitive one, showcasing the intensity and skill that characterizes Turkish basketball. Fenerbahçe Beko's victory is significant as it positions the team among the elite in the Turkish league, where rivalries run deep and fan engagement is passionate. The Final Four will feature other top-tier teams, making it a critical juncture in the season for all involved. The outcome of these matches can influence team dynamics, player morale, and future recruitment strategies. Key stakeholders in this event include the Turkish Basketball Federation, which oversees the tournament, and the various sponsors and media outlets that promote the sport. The success of Fenerbahçe Beko can lead to increased investment in basketball infrastructure and youth programs, further nurturing the sport's growth in Turkey. Additionally, the club's performance may have implications for its players, who could attract attention from international leagues, thereby enhancing their career prospects. The implications of Fenerbahçe Beko's success extend beyond the court. The team's achievements can inspire local youth to engage in sports, fostering a sense of community and teamwork. Furthermore, as basketball continues to gain traction in Turkey, it may also influence international perceptions of Turkish sports culture, potentially leading to more cross-border collaborations and events. As the Final Four approaches, the excitement surrounding Turkish basketball is likely to grow, drawing attention from both local and international audiences.
